Oracle表空间满:现象及解决策略

原创 旧城等待, 2025-02-16 22:15 29阅读 0赞

在Oracle数据库中,当一个表空间(Tablespace)满了,会出现以下几种现象:

  1. 错误日志:系统会生成”ORA-0165”或类似错误,指出表空间已满。

  2. 性能下降:访问数据库的请求可能会被延迟或者拒绝,导致应用程序运行缓慢。

  3. 空间回收策略:如果设置为自动回收,Oracle会在后台尝试清理一些不再需要的数据,以释放空间。

解决策略:

  1. 增加表空间大小:可以通过ALTER TABLESPACE命令增大表空间容量。

  2. 删除或压缩数据:定期检查表空间使用情况,并根据需求进行数据清理或压缩。

  3. 优化存储参数:如REUSE_SIZE、PCT_FREE等,调整以达到更好的性能和空间利用率。

文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。

发表评论

表情:
评论列表 (有 0 条评论,29人围观)

还没有评论,来说两句吧...

相关阅读